Lana Del Rey

Lana Del Rey, born Elizabeth Woolridge Grant on June 21, 1985, is an American singer-songwriter who has become an emblematic figure in alternative pop music with her cinematic sound and aesthetic that blends melancholic nostalgia with contemporary glamour. Del Rey emerged on the music scene in 2011 with her viral hit "Video Games" and solidified her rise to fame with her second album "Born to Die" in 2012, which established her as a unique voice with its themes of tragic romance, glamour, and melancholia. Her music often reflects a fusion of modern and vintage sensibilities, characterized by its cinematic quality and references to American pop culture, particularly the 1950s and 1960s.

Over the years, Lana Del Rey has accumulated a devoted fanbase and critical acclaim for her distinct style and contribution to the music industry. She has consistently demonstrated her versatility as an artist with each album exploring new creative territories while staying true to her signature sound. Her more recent releases, such as "Say Yes To Heaven" and its various remixes, show her willingness to reinterpret her work and collaborate with other artists, allowing her songs to resonate in different musical landscapes. Del Rey's work has also been marked by her poetic songwriting and thematic introspection, seen in tracks like "Did you know that there's a tunnel under Ocean Blvd". Meanwhile, reimaginings of her classics, such as "Summertime Sadness (Sped Up)," underscore how her music continues to connect with listeners in ever-transforming ways, demonstrating her enduring relevance in the music world.
